Miter Saw Mastery: Cutting Aluminium with Precision

Achieving crisp cuts of aluminium with your power saw demands particular techniques. Compared to wood, aluminum tends to melt to the cutting surface , potentially causing a rough edge and kickback . To circumvent this, always use a high-tooth blade built for soft metals. Decreasing the cutting speed – that's how fast you push the aluminum into the blade – is critical ; a gradual approach yields far better results. Moreover , lubricating the blade with a oil can more info reduce friction and improve the final cut precision.

Choosing the Correct Miter Saw for Alloy Projects

When handling metal projects, selecting the ideal miter saw is critical . Standard miter saws can struggle and harm the lightweight material, leading to poor cuts and wasted pieces. Look for a device with a precision blade specifically intended for soft metals, or consider a cold-cutting miter machine which prevents heat buildup and minimizes the risk of warping . The ability to modify blade revolutions is also beneficial for creating clean, clean cuts.
